Manager, Corporate Programs & Contracts

Basic Function: This position serves as the highest level team member for reviewing, strategically responding to and designating necessary work groups to manage and execute contract administration for maximum sales. This includes ensuring the successful delivery of technical performance, adherence to schedule and budgetary constraints, and strict compliance with all applicable internal policies and external regulatory requirements and directives.
Significant Responsibilities:
Performs specific job responsibilities:
Contracts Administration:
- Manages the analysis, review, and oversight of government and private contracts; collaborates with and provides guidance to the sales team responsible for this business; ensures leading edge and up to date knowledge of the government contracting climate;
- Uses FARS and DFARS knowledge to serve as the primary lead ensuring contract requirements are understood and met by the team involved in managing customer relationships; directs others in their work related to the contract and/or corporate program.
- Works with sales, engineering, operations, HR, IT, and other departments to understand internal processes and policies related to compliance requirements, holds self-responsible for maintaining up-to-date information from these groups.
- Manages OCC’s formal responses to contractual issues and customer inquiries – either working directly with the customer or involving/advising the lead salesperson as appropriate.
- Manages OCC’s customer portal access: maintains access, grants access to others as appropriate
- Uses general business experience to review contracts for private customers.
Compliance
- Maintains a constant pulse on OCC compliance practices and processes against the ever-changing contract requirements, especially in federal and defense contracting to avoid or predict non-compliance issues with advance notice.
- Regularly communicates compliance changes to the leadership and sales team for them to make adjustments.
- Effectively and efficiently manages the “process” of contract administration.
- Understand the commonalities amongst contracts and supplier certifications to collect and manage an internal informational “catalog” for OCC
- Maintains calendars to ensure renewal certifications are proactively completed
- Regular communication with sales to ensure compliance is managed alongside their goal of growing sales.

Job Scope:
- Organizational Responsibility: This position is responsible for coordinating and providing direction and feedback to senior staff and functional managers across all facilities concerning technical programs, projects and compliance programs as well as developing or interpreting contractual agreements. The position requires extensive knowledge across a wide spectrum of corporate functions and activities as well as broad knowledge of specialized external requirements.
- Communication: This position requires excellent written and verbal communication skills as well as the ability to facilitate and lead discussions on a variety of technical and management issues. The role includes writing technical specifications and procedures, contractual agreements, customer correspondence and presentations, and other such documents as are required to promote and achieve corporate goals.
- Confidentiality: This role often involves dealing with delicate corporate issues that are highly sensitive and confidential.
- Financial Responsibility: This role is responsible for planning and management of major corporate programs and projects including much of the defense related work, which comprises approximately 20% of the company’s annual revenue.
- Judgment: The role requires a consistently high level of judgment due to the nature of the role. Errors in judgment could have a serious impact on critical customer relationships with long-term impact in revenue.
- Compliance: The role has significant bearing for corporate compliance with federal acquisition regulations (FARs and DFAR’s) as well as other areas including Qualified Products List (QPL) for military products, and ISO-9001 Quality Management System (QMS) requirements.
- Travel: The role requires some travel to other OCC facilities, suppliers / test facilities and customer facilities. Travel times can range from overnight to several weeks duration.
Minimum Qualifications Required:
Education: Bachelor degree in Business Administration, Contracts Management, Supply Chain or related fields. Master Degree in Business Administration or equivalent experience preferred.
Experience: This role requires a minimum of 4-6 years of experience on the following subject matters:
- FARS and DFARS
- CMMC and NIST-800 (in order to provide support to the IT team member managing CMMC compliance)
- Contracts review, analysis and oversight (government and private)
- Non-Disclosure Agreements
Licensure, Certification and/or Registration: Project Management Professional (PMP), Certified Federal Contracts Manager (CFCM) or other applicable certification preferred
Other Minimum Qualifications: This role requires a high level of proficiency with MS Office applications (Word, Excel and PowerPoint) as well as expert level proficiency with MS Project.
Essential Skills, Abilities & Knowledge: This role requires a high degree of written and verbal communication skills along with the ability to effectively form and lead project teams of highly skilled and strong willed technical and management personnel in a matrix organization. This role also requires the ability to develop and communicate complex project plans that accurately reflect both requirements and processes and convey project status to stake holders in a clear and succinct manner. The role also requires the ability to foresee and eliminate or minimize risk and/or develop and implement effective solutions to difficult and complex problems. This role operates with minimal or no supervision, but must be able to seek out and/or discern useful guidance from various stakeholders.
Working Conditions: This role is predominantly office based and requires extended periods of managing multiple tasks concurrently and being able to accommodate and respond to unplanned high priority tasks at a moment’s notice. The role requires significant computer work, but also requires work in both production and test laboratory areas as well as customer and supplier facilities, requiring an understanding of basic safety procedures. Must work well under tight deadlines and changing priorities. Reasonable accommodation may be made to enable individuals with a disability to perform the essential functions.
T his role involves work contracted by the U.S. government and/or other federal agencies, which requires that all personnel involved in such work are U.S. citizens or Lawful Permanent Residents. Thus, a qualified candidate for this position must be able to present valid documentation indicating that they are a U.S. citizen or Lawful Permanent Resident.
